Default Prophecies and EOTN Heroes

I've searched a bit both here and on several GW sites but can't seem to find a good guide. I only have [P] and [EOTN], and I'm wondering how durable and effective my heroes can be when lacking the other 2 campaigns. If anyone has advice or website links that would be great. I'm just looking to go through all of EOTN with my heroes, and possibly HM.

A friend of mine has a similar problem, he got all EotN heroes but that's just not enough to make a good working team for HM, because you lack at skills.
The Factions and NF skills you don't have are really big problem, because you have either little skills for self and no skills for sin Anton, rit Xandra, para Hayda and derv Kahmu, just their default bars and a few EotN skills.

However it's possible to complete campaigns in NM or do some easy stuff, but it's not real GW and it's no as fun. Consider buying at least NF, people here can advise where to get it in your location for the lowest price. You will need people's help. Find yourself a friendly helpful guild.

P.S. You can get in total 11 heroes with Prophecies and EotN only. One hero of each proffesion + extra paragon Keiran. But you won't have skills for 5 of them.

The problem with heroes is in your case not the weapons or runes or level. The problem is their skillbars. So first of all forget bout the sin/derv/rit/para-heroes in eye of the north. you can get them if you like, but you can't get them any decent build.

Secondly keep in mind you can also bring henchman. The Eye of the North henchman are rather good if you compare them to prophecy henchman AND though they have a fixed skillbar, they got skills from all campagns and their builds are pretty balanced.

http://wiki.guildwars.com/wiki/List_...North_henchmen

So if your team of heroes are still work in progress cause you can't get them all skills yet (the ones available for you in eotn and prophecy's) don't bring the hero and use a henchman instead. on default the hero's are rubbish compared to hecnhman. Only after you provided them with runes, weapons and balanced builds hey become better.

It might happen that you run into quests in eye of the north that are too hard in nm. if so you might need to find help. Some of them are rather hard. Specially the last ones of every arc (and all of the dwarves arc).

Actually, after an update a while back, the prophecies henchmen have pretty nice setups, so you should be able to do much (or all) of HM with only GWEN heroes if desired.

However, you will find difficulty running any of the current meta team setups, since they make use of both heroes and skills from the other campaigns. You will not be able to effectively use any ritualist, assassin, dervish or paragon heroes without the skills from the corresponding campaigns, but you can still use any of the core professions to good effect with only prophecies skills. If you find that you're missing a hero of a certain profession for a certain team-setup, you may want to consider buying a few mercenary heroes to round out your team.

The game is definitely harder this way, but if you experiment and play smartly, you can still do most of the content in those two areas.
